> To access them you type in the url field about:config and then hit enter
> (just like any Mozilla based browser). Then place network.proxy.http in the
> Filter field to bring it into view.
> Right clicking on the network.proxy.http setting should bring up a menu.
> Double clicking may bring up an edit dialog. Strange that it is greyed out.
>
>
Yup. it's a bug.
- http://dev.laptop.org/ticket/5238
Fixed in Update.1, but still broke in Marie's 656.
